在腾讯云服务器上运行多个网站可以有效地利用资源,降低成本,提高效率。本文将为您介绍如何在腾讯云服务器上运行多个网站。
- 确定服务器规格和操作系统
首先,需要根据实际需求选择适合的服务器规格和操作系统。腾讯云服务器提供多种规格和操作系统选择,如 Linux 和 Windows 等,可以根据需要选择不同的配置。
- 安装 Web 服务器
在服务器上安装 Web 服务器是运行网站的第一步。常见的 Web 服务器有 Apache、Nginx 和 IIS 等。在 Linux 操作系统上,可以使用命令行安装 Apache 或 Nginx。在 Windows 操作系统上,可以下载安装 IIS。
- 配置虚拟服务器
在多个网站共享一个服务器的情况下,需要配置虚拟服务器。虚拟服务器可以让多个网站共享同一个 IP 地址和端口。在 Apache 中,可以使用 VirtualHost 配置虚拟服务器。在 Nginx 中,可以使用 server 块配置虚拟服务器。在 IIS 中,可以使用站点配置来配置虚拟服务器。
- 绑定域名
为每个网站绑定域名可以让用户通过域名访问网站。可以在腾讯云上购买域名,或者将现有的域名迁移至腾讯云。在域名管理控制台中,可以将域名解析到服务器的 IP 地址上。
- 配置 SSL 证书
为网站配置 SSL 证书可以保护用户数据的安全。可以在腾讯云上购买 SSL 证书,或者使用 Let's Encrypt 等免费证书。在 Web 服务器上配置 SSL 证书需要按照相应的指南进行操作。
- 配置数据库
如果网站需要使用数据库,可以在腾讯云上购买云数据库,或者在服务器上安装数据库软件。在配置数据库时,需要注意安全设置和权限管理。
- 网站备份和监控
定期备份网站数据可以保证数据安全,可以使用腾讯云提供的云备份服务。同时,需要配置监控服务,监控服务器和网站的运行状态,以及 CPU、内存和网络等资源的使用情况。
总之,通过以上步骤,您可以在腾讯云服务器上运行多个网站,提高资源利用率和效率,降低成本,提高用户体验。